Bean Onion Salad

Prep: 20 min Cuisine: American

A vibrant bean onion salad combining multiple beans, crunchy celery, and sweet onions, all coated in a tangy vinegar and oil dressing. This refreshing dish is perfect for picnics, potlucks, or as a side, offering a balanced mix of flavors and textures that appeal to various tastes.

Ingredients

  • 1 can red kidney beans
  • 1 can wax beans
  • 1 can green beans
  • 1 small bunch celery
  • 3/4 cup sugar
  • 1 onion
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up vinegar
  • 1/2 cup corn oil

Instructions

  1. Drain the canned beans; add finely chopped celery and chopped onion.
  2. Combine sugar, vinegar, salt, and corn oil; mix well.
  3. Pour the dressing over the beans and vegetables, and mix thoroughly.
  4. Let stand for several hours before serving.
  5. Keep refrigerated; serves well when chilled.
